Perfect Pumpkin Cheesecake Cream Cheese Filled Cookies
These soft pumpkin cookies hide a creamy, sweet cheesecake surprise inside. They are a wonderful fall dessert that everyone will enjoy. 
Key Ingredients & Tips for Filled Pumpkin Cookies
- Cream Cheese Filling: Make sure your cream cheese is soft for a smooth, lump-free filling. A little vanilla adds great taste.
- Pumpkin Puree: Use pure pumpkin puree, not pumpkin pie filling. It helps keep the cookies moist and gives real pumpkin flavor.
- Sealing the Filling: Pinch the cookie dough firmly around the cream cheese ball to prevent it from leaking during baking.
What You Need for Pumpkin Cheesecake Cookies
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/4 cup light brown s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1/2 cup pumpkin puree
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- For the Filling: 4 oz cream cheese, softened; 1/4 cup powdered sugar; 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
⏱️ Time: 45 minutes🍽️ Yields: 18-20 cookies
How to Make Pumpkin Cheesecake Cookies
Step 1: Prepare the Filling
In a small bowl, beat softened cream cheese, powdered sugar, and vanilla until smooth. Drop small spoonfuls onto a parchment-lined plate and freeze for about 15-20 minutes until firm.
Step 2: Make the Cookie Dough
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line baking sheets with parchment paper. Cream together but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light. Beat in the egg, pumpkin puree, and vanilla extract until well combined.
Step 3: Combine and Fill
In another b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, baking soda, pumpkin pie spice,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ined. Take a spoonful of dough, flatten it, place a frozen cream cheese ball in the center, and wrap the dough around it, sealing completely.
Step 4: Bake the Cookies
Place filled cookie dough balls on prepared baking sheets, leaving space between them.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until the edges are set and lightly golden. Let them c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before moving to a wire rack to cool completely.
📝 Final Note
Store these filled pumpkin cookies in an airtight container in the refrigerator to keep the cream cheese filling fresh and tasty.
Creamy Pumpkin Cream Cheese Frosted Cookies
These soft pumpkin cookies are topped with a generous layer of tangy cream cheese frosting. It’s a classic pairing that just feels right for autumn. 
Key Ingredients & Tips for Frosted Pumpkin Cookies
- Softened Butter & Cream Cheese: For the frosting, make sure both are truly softened. This helps you get a super smooth and creamy frosting.
- Don’t Overmix Cookie Dough: Mixing too much can make cookies tough. Mix dry ingredients into wet until just combined.
What You Need for Pumpkin Frosted Cookies
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/4 cup light brown s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1/2 cup pumpkin puree
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- For the Frosting: 4 oz cream cheese, softened; 1/4 cup unsalted butter, softened; 2 cups powdered sugar; 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
⏱️ Time: 40 minutes🍽️ Yields: 2 dozen cookies
How to Make Frosted Pumpkin Cookies
Step 1: Prepare Cookie Dough
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line baking sheets. Cream together but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ar. Beat in the egg, pumpkin puree, and vanilla. In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, baking soda, pumpkin pie spice, and salt. Slowly add dry ingredients to wet, mixing until just combined.
Step 2: Bake Cookies
Drop spoonfuls of dough onto baking sheets. Bake for 10-12 minutes until edges are lightly golden and centers are set. Let cookies cool completely on a wire rack before frosting.
Step 3: Make Frosting
In a medium bowl, beat softened cream cheese and butter until smooth. Slowly add powdered sugar, one cup at a time, beating until fluffy. Stir in vanilla extract.
Step 4: Frost and Serve
Once the cookies are completely cool, spread a generous amount of cream cheese frosting on top of each cookie. Serve and enjoy!
📝 Final Note
If you have leftover frosting, it stores well in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week.
Sweet Pumpkin Nutella Cookies
These unique cookies bring together the warm flavors of pumpkin with the beloved sweetness of Nutella. They are a delightful surprise for your taste buds. 
Key Ingredients & Tips for Nutella Pumpkin Cookies
- Nutella Swirl: For a nice swirl, add dollops of Nutella to the dough right before forming cookies and gently mix once or twice.
- Brown Sugar Boost: Using brown sugar helps keep these cookies soft and adds a richer, molasses-like flavor that pairs well with Nutella.
What You Need for Pumpkin Nutella Cookies
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/4 cup light brown s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1/2 cup pumpkin puree
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 cup Nutella
⏱️ Time: 35 minutes🍽️ Yields: 2 dozen cookies
How to Make Nutella Pumpkin Cookies
Step 1: Mix Wet Ingredients
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line baking sheets. In a large bowl, cream together soft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until fluffy. Beat in the egg, pumpkin puree, and vanilla extract until smooth.
Step 2: Add Dry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, baking soda, pumpkin pie spice, and salt. Gradually add these d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ing until just combined.
Step 3: Incorporate Nutella and Bake
Gently fold in the Nutella, creating a marbled effect without overmixing. Drop spoonfuls of dough onto the prepared baking sheets.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are golden. Let them c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before moving to a wire rack.
📝 Final Note
These pumpkin Nutella cookies are especially good served warm, perhaps with a cold glass of milk!
Classic Pumpkin Pie Cookies
Enjoy all the comforting flavors of a pumpkin pie in a convenient, handheld cookie form. These are ideal for holiday gatherings or a cozy afternoon treat. 
Key Ingredients & Tips for Pumpkin Pie Cookies
- Pumpkin Pie Spice: This is key for the authentic pumpkin pie taste. You can adjust the amount to your liking.
- Chilling the Dough: Chilling helps make the dough easier to work with, especially if you plan to roll it out and cut shapes.
What You Need for Pumpkin Pie Cookies
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/4 cup light brown s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1/2 cup pumpkin puree
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- Optional Glaze: 1 cup powdered sugar, 2-3 tablespoons milk, 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ract
⏱️ Time: 45 minutes🍽️ Yields: 2-3 dozen cookies
How to Make Pumpkin Pie Cookies
Step 1: Make Cookie Dough
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line baking sheets. Cream together soft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ar. Beat in the egg, pumpkin puree, and vanilla extract.
Step 2: Add Dry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, pumpkin pie spice,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ing until a soft dough forms.
Step 3: Shape and Bake
Drop rounded spoonfuls of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, or roll out the dough and use cookie cutters. Bake for 10-12 minutes until the edges are set. Let cool completely on a wire rack.
Step 4: Glaze (Optional)
If desired, whisk together pow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la for a simple glaze. Drizzle or spread over cooled cookies. Let the glaze set before serving.
📝 Final Note
These pumpkin pie cookies pair perfectly with a dollop of whipped cream or a sprinkle of extra cinnamon.
Soft Pumpkin Snickerdoodle Cookies
A delightful fall version of a classic, these pumpkin snickerdoodle cookies are soft, chewy, and coated in sweet cinnamon sugar. They are a comforting treat for any cool day. 
Key Ingredients & Tips for Pumpkin Snickerdoodles
- Cream of Tartar: This ingredient is essential for the classic snickerdoodle tang and helps give them their soft, chewy texture.
- Cinnamon Sugar Coating: Roll the dough balls completely in the cinnamon-sugar mixture before baking for a perfect crisp outer layer.
What You Need for Pumpkin Snickerdoodle Cookies
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/4 cup light brown s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1/4 cup pumpkin puree
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on cream of tartar
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- For the Coating: 1/4 cup granulated sugar, 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
⏱️ Time: 35 minutes🍽️ Yields: 2 dozen cookies
How to Make Pumpkin Snickerdoodles
Step 1: Mix Wet Ingredients
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line baking sheets. In a large bowl, cream together soft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in the egg, pumpkin puree, and vanilla extract until well combined.
Step 2: Combine Dry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, cream of tartar, baking soda, pumpkin pie spice,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ing until just combined.
Step 3: Coat and Bake
In a small shallow dish, combine the granulated sugar and cinnamon for the coating. Roll spoonfuls of cookie dough into balls, then roll them generously in the cinnamon-sugar mixture. Place on prepared baking sheets. Bake for 9-11 minutes, or until the edges are set but the centers are still soft.
Step 4: Cool
Let the cookies c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. This helps them set without becoming too firm.
📝 Final Note
For extra softness, do not overbake. These cookies are best when they are slightly underdone in the center.
Delicate Pumpkin Snowball Cookies
These delicate pumpkin snowball cookies are light, buttery, and coated in sweet powdered sugar. They have a subtle pumpkin flavor that makes them perfect for fall and winter. 
Key Ingredients & Tips for Pumpkin Snowball Cookies
- Finely Chopped Nuts: Use finely chopped pecans or walnuts. They provide a nice texture without making the cookies difficult to form.
- Double Coating: Rolling the cookies in powdered sugar twice (once warm, once cool) ensures a thick, snowy coating that stays put.
What You Need for Pumpkin Snowball Cookies
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1/2 cup powdered sugar (for dough)
- 1/4 cup pumpkin puree
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 cup finely chopped pecans or walnuts
- For Coating: 1 1/2 cups powdered sugar
⏱️ Time: 40 minutes🍽️ Yields: 3 dozen cookies
How to Make Pumpkin Snowball Cookies
Step 1: Make Dough
Preheat your oven to 325°F (160°C) and line baking sheets. In a large bowl, cream softened butter and powdered sugar until light. Beat in pumpkin puree and vanilla extract.
Step 2: Add Dry Ingredients and Nuts
Gradually add the flour and salt to the wet mixture, mixing until a dough forms. Stir in the finely chopped nuts. Roll the dough into small, 1-inch balls and place them on the prepared baking sheets.
Step 3: Bake and First Roll
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until the cookies are lightly golden on the bottom. While the cookies are still warm, gently roll them in about 1/2 cup of powdered sugar until fully coated.
Step 4: Cool and Second Roll
Transfer the coated cookies to a wire rack to cool completely. Once cool, roll them again in the remaining powdered sugar for a final, beautiful snowy finish.
📝 Final Note
Store these pumpkin snowball cookies in an airtight container at room temperature to keep them fresh and powdery.
